UC Davis Law vs. UOP Law

The following statements compares Davis School of Law (UC Davis Law) and McGeorge School of Law (UOP Law) with important law school statistics. All data is for the academic year 2023-2024, except bar passage and employment data for 2022-2023.
  • UC Davis Law tuition of $67,164 is more expensive than UOP Law tuition of $59,580.
  • UOP Law offers the better financial aid of $28,679 which is 48.14% of tuition amount.
  • UC Davis Law acceptance rate of 61.31% is lower than UOP Law of 28.99%.
  • UC Davis Law's LSAT score of 165 is higher than UOP Law of 155.
  • UC Davis Law's GPA of 3.69 is higher than UOP Law of 3.40.
  • UC Davis Law with 718 students is larger than UOP Law with 666 students.
  • UC Davis Law has higher bar exam pass rate than UOP Law.
  • UOP Law founded in 1924 is older than UC Davis Law founded in 1965.
  • Both schools do not require application fees.
